How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 23232?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
23232 Studio Apartments | $1,354 | $850 | $3,288 |
23232 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,665 | $700 | $4,597 |
23232 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,040 | $832 | $9,499 |
23232 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,747 | $879 | $7,150 |
23232 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,280 | $756 | $7,250 |
